Text
Discrimination between individuals of the same class in the amount of premiums or rates charged for any individual health insurance policy, or in the benefits payable thereon, or in any of the terms or conditions of such policy, or in any other manner, is prohibited. See Sec. 38a-446 re prohibition against discrimination in favor of individuals by life insurance companies. See Sec. 38a-447 re prohibition of discrimination against persons on basis of race. See Sec. 38a-816 re unfair practices.

Legislative History
(1949 Rev., S. 6188; 1951, S. 2844d; P.A. 90-243, S. 78.) History: P.A. 90-243 substituted reference to “individual health insurance” policy for reference to policies under Secs. 38-165 to 38-172; Sec. 38-172 transferred to Sec. 38a-488 in 1991.
